Literature: Philippe Dufour is prominently featured in Twelve Faces of Time: Horological Virtuosos by Elisabeth Doerr and Ralph Baumgarten pp. 10-25 and in Masters of Contemporary Watchmaking by Michael Clerizo pp. 72-91.The Duality was introduced in 1996. Dufour’s second wristwatch was, like the Grande & Petite Sonnerie wristwatch, a world première: the world’s first wristwatch incorporating a double escapement (thus its name)featuring two independent balance wheels compensated with a central differential gear. Having two balances connected in this way enables greater accuracy as it allows the balances to average out their rates. If one runs slightly faster and the other a bit slower, the rate variations would cancel each other out. Furthermore, this system produces less variation across all different positions. Dufour is a fervent defender of his beloved Vallée de Joux, where he was born, grew up and now working. His inspiration for the Duality came from a school watch from the Vallée de Joux watchmaking school – the same school that Dufour graduated from. This watch had a single gear train delivering power to two balance wheels through a differential. After having miniaturized the Grande & Petite movement to fit inside a wristwatch, Dufour tackled the task of shrinking the differential into a caliber that could be housed within a wristwatch. The final result was nothing short of extraordinary and a sight to behold as he managed to shrink the differential mechanism to the size of a matchstick head allowing the movement to feature two large balances beating in unison. Dufour had planning on making 25 Duality timepieces, however, due to the complexity of making, assembling and adjusting the movement and to the fact that the market did not grasp the importance and relevance of the timepiece he only made 9. The present example in pink gold is one of only three made in this metal. Furthermore, considering that Dufour had also made a Duality n°00 (sold at Phillips New York 26 Oct 2017 for $915,000), the present Duality n°8 is the last one he made.
